Short-Term Problems of Alcohol Consumption
Introduction to Short-Term Alcohol Problems
Alcohol consumption, even in the short term, can lead to a variety of immediate health and cognitive issues. These problems can range from memory impairments to increased risk of accidents and social issues. Understanding these short-term effects is crucial for both individuals and healthcare providers to mitigate risks and promote healthier behaviors.
Cognitive Impairments and Memory Issues
Short-Term Memory Deficits
Short-term alcohol consumption can significantly impair cognitive functions, particularly short-term memory. Studies have shown that acute alcohol intake can lead to poorer recall, altered spatial recognition, and reduced cognitive flexibility. In animal models, chronic alcohol consumption has been linked to residual short-term memory deficits, even after a period of abstinence. This suggests that the impact on memory can persist beyond the immediate period of consumption.
Working Memory and Executive Function
Alcohol also affects working memory and other executive functions, such as planning and task-switching. The type of cognitive task used in studies can influence the outcomes, with some tasks showing more pronounced deficits than others. For instance, tasks requiring complex sequencing or high cognitive load are particularly affected by alcohol consumption.
Health-Related Consequences
Biological Markers and Health Quality
Short-term alcohol consumption can lead to various negative health outcomes. While self-reported alcohol consumption and related health issues may decrease with brief interventions, biological markers such as carbohydrate-deficient transferrin (CDT) and gamma-glutamyl transferase (gamma-GT) levels do not show corresponding reductions. This indicates that while individuals may perceive improvements, underlying biological impacts may persist.
Glutamatergic Neurotransmission
Alcohol disrupts glutamatergic neurotransmission, which can lead to neurophysiological and pathological effects. Acute alcohol intake blocks NMDA receptor-mediated neurotransmission, potentially leading to neuronal toxicity and apoptotic cell death. These effects contribute to the broader spectrum of alcohol-related neurobiological issues, including dependence and withdrawal symptoms.
Social and Behavioral Issues
Risk Factors and Social Deviance
Short-term alcohol problems are also influenced by social and behavioral factors. Individuals with high social deviance and low short-term memory capacity are at greater risk for alcohol problems. This suggests that cognitive abilities can moderate the impact of social behaviors on alcohol-related issues.
Binge Drinking and Cerebral Dysfunction
Binge drinking, even over a short period, can lead to significant cerebral dysfunction. Electrophysiological studies have shown that binge drinkers exhibit delayed latencies in event-related potentials, indicating slowed cerebral activity. These changes are not always detectable through behavioral measures alone, highlighting the need for more sensitive diagnostic tools.
Effectiveness of Brief Interventions
Reducing Alcohol Consumption
Brief interventions in primary care settings have been shown to reduce alcohol consumption among hazardous and harmful drinkers. These interventions typically involve conversations with healthcare providers, feedback on alcohol use, and advice on reducing intake. While these interventions can lead to moderate reductions in alcohol consumption, their impact on binge drinking frequency and drinking intensity is less pronounced.
Patient Satisfaction and Treatment Approaches
Patients generally report higher satisfaction with more intensive treatment approaches, such as guided self-change sessions, compared to single-session advice. This suggests that individuals may benefit from more comprehensive support when addressing alcohol-related problems.
Conclusion
Short-term alcohol consumption can lead to a range of immediate cognitive, health, and social problems. Memory impairments, disrupted neurotransmission, and increased risk of social deviance are some of the key issues associated with short-term alcohol use. While brief interventions can help reduce consumption, more intensive and sustained support may be necessary to address the underlying biological and cognitive impacts. Understanding these short-term effects is essential for developing effective prevention and treatment strategies.
